Chip tuning for Mercedes G 65 AMG (6.0T) 612 hp ECU

Mercedes G (2000 - W463-II) 65 AMG (6.0T) 612 hp — premium petrol engine of the passenger segment of the Mercedes-Benz Group AG (Mercedes-Benz, AMG, Maybach, Smart, EQ) group (Германия, 1926). Stage 1 chip tuning raises power from 612 to 646 hp (+34 hp, +6%) and torque from 1000 to 1100 Nm (+100 Nm). ECU — Bosch ME2.7.1. Flashing method: OBD or Bench depending on the unit's protection. How many horsepower does the Mercedes G 65 AMG (6.0T) 612 hp reach after a remap?

After Stage 1 the power of the Mercedes G 65 AMG (6.0T) 612 hp rises from 612 to 646 hp, a gain of 34 hp (+6%). Torque rises from 1000 to 1100 Nm (+100 Nm).

How does Stage 1 differ from stock on the Mercedes G?

Stage 1 is a software optimization of the factory ECU firmware of the Mercedes G with no hardware changes. The injection, boost, ignition-timing and torque maps are reprogrammed. The gain is +34 hp with no hardware changes.

What ECU platform does the Mercedes G 65 AMG (6.0T) 612 hp use?

The Mercedes G 65 AMG (6.0T) 612 hp is fitted with the Bosch ME2.7.1 ECU. The read method depends on the unit's protection: OBD, Bench via BDM, or Boot mode.

How long is the wait for a Stage 1 remap for the Mercedes G?

Reading and writing via OBD takes 25-30 minutes on the Mercedes G. Bench reading (BDM/JTAG) takes about 60 minutes plus refitting. Remote file processing at CHIPOK takes 5-30 minutes.
